Systems integration is the process of linking different computing systems and applications to exchange, integrate, and cooperatively use information in a coordinated manner. It's a critical aspect of modern business operations, enabling the seamless flow of data across different systems and applications. The integration process involves several steps, including analysis, design, implementation, and post-implementation support. It requires a deep understanding of the business processes involved and the technical capabilities of the systems being integrated. The success of a systems integration project depends on the ability to manage and mitigate risks, ensure data integrity, and meet the business requirements.
